Factbox-US companies adjust diversity policies as challenges rise Reuters

(Reuters) – Meta Platforms (NASDAQ: ) and Amazon.com (NASDAQ: ) have joined a growing number of U.S. companies in reducing their diversity, equity, and inclusion (DEI) initiatives, aimed at improving racial and ethnic representation in workplaces against a background of pressure ascending from successive groups.

At least six major US companies, including JPMorgan Chase (NYSE: ), changed their DEI policies last year, according to a Reuters review of company statements.

Here is a list of companies that have dropped the DEI program or made changes to some of the policies in 2024:
